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
755638209 28 9511 5756120
87584648142 98897
87584648142 98897
6588683 531 63
All about undefined
Interested in learning more?
87584648142 98897
6588683 531 63
See more
6463865895 09518819
33237207 35694607303 47111
See more
460125447 01973
495940 789 195966872 16396149 454
See more